Arrow Senior Living is a distinguished management company specializing in senior living communities across five states including Missouri, Iowa, Illinois, Ohio, and Indiana. With a portfolio of 25 properties, Arrow Senior Living provides a broad range of care options such as independent living, assisted living, and memory care. Employing nearly 1,400 dedicated staff members, Arrow Senior Living emphasizes creating a supportive and home-like environment not only for their residents but also for team members. Job Duties
- Prepare menu items according to established standards and recipes
- Provide exceptional quality food that is attractively presented in a timely manner
- Ensure health protocols are followed including proper hygiene, sanitary food preparation, and proper food temperatures
- Familiarize with residents preferences and needs
- Participate in resident orientations
- Maintain cleanliness and organization of the kitchen and work areas
- Adhere to safety and sanitation standards
